示例#1
0
 $ca->setTemplate("clientareadetails");
 $uneditablefields = explode(",", $CONFIG['ClientsProfileUneditableFields']);
 $smartyvalues['uneditablefields'] = $uneditablefields;
 $e = "";
 if ($save) {
     check_token();
     $e = checkDetailsareValid($client->getID(), false);
     if ($e) {
         $ca->assign("errormessage", $e);
     } else {
         $client->updateClient();
         $ca->assign("successful", true);
     }
 }
 if (!$e) {
     $exdetails = $client->getDetails();
 }
 include "includes/countries.php";
 $ca->assign("clientfirstname", $whmcs->get_req_var_if($e, "firstname", $exdetails));
 $ca->assign("clientlastname", $whmcs->get_req_var_if($e, "lastname", $exdetails));
 $ca->assign("clientcompanyname", $whmcs->get_req_var_if($e, "companyname", $exdetails));
 $ca->assign("clientemail", $whmcs->get_req_var_if($e, "email", $exdetails));
 $ca->assign("clientaddress1", $whmcs->get_req_var_if($e, "address1", $exdetails));
 $ca->assign("clientaddress2", $whmcs->get_req_var_if($e, "address2", $exdetails));
 $ca->assign("clientcity", $whmcs->get_req_var_if($e, "city", $exdetails));
 $ca->assign("clientstate", $whmcs->get_req_var_if($e, "state", $exdetails));
 $ca->assign("clientpostcode", $whmcs->get_req_var_if($e, "postcode", $exdetails));
 $ca->assign("clientcountry", $countries[$whmcs->get_req_var_if($e, "country", $exdetails)]);
 $ca->assign("clientcountriesdropdown", getCountriesDropDown($whmcs->get_req_var_if($e, "country", $exdetails)));
 $ca->assign("clientphonenumber", $whmcs->get_req_var_if($e, "phonenumber", $exdetails));
 $ca->assign("customfields", getCustomFields("client", "", $client->getID(), "", "", $_POST['customfield']));